    Default Really glad I upgraded

    After a little over a year and a half of using a straight razor I decided to purchase a new strop. My first strop was a TM 4-sided paddle strop with three sides meant for pastes and one with just plain leather for daily stropping. This strop was ideal for me at the time since I was able to refresh the edge with diamond pastes instead of getting it honed.

    For a year now I've been refreshing my blades on a C12k and shaving straight off it with great results, so I haven't been going to the pastes. As a result I was only using the leather side of my paddle strop, giving it about 70 laps and then shaving. I figured I had a good enough setup and my shaves were great, so I didn't see the point in buying a new strop with one of them fancy fabric sides.

    As time went past though, I began to look more and more at hanging strops and how maybe I should get one since they always seemed to be the "proper traditional" thing to use.

    A recent change in jobs finally let me have a little wiggle room for discretionary spending while still putting away enough for grad school so I picked up this baby: http://http://www.fendrihan.com/latigo-strop-with-ring-p-637.html

    It's not the fanciest strop but my last few shaves with using it have been like night and day compared to my other strop. This thing has put an insanely smooth edge on my razors that when I first used it I though that I had screwed up and rolled the edge. After checking, I saw that it was still cutting hair, but was gliding across my face like it was butter. I thought the shaves I was getting before were good, but this is ridiculous.

    I'm not sure what exactly it is, but I suspect it has to be some combination of stropping on fabric before the leather and having more of a stropping surface. I've been going 50 laps fabric/50 laps leather, and it's been pure bliss.

    Of course, if you do say 60 laps on a standard sized hanging strop vs 60 on one of those itty bitty travel type paddles you would have to increase the laps on the paddle so the time the razor spends on the leather is about the same. The fabric strop as you have surmised does improve things also.
